Output ec1b65e8050d7fa3aa380c4c45f56cf413d4f06a4e450c1b109c1882381d90aa:13

value
2392468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a5b7acf4795bb6eb9066afdf4aaf64aa223a19a OP_EQUALVERIFY OP_CHECKSIG
address
1AhNDTVaXvNp9y3k6FHwe4PXFiZrt3YjNS
transaction
ec1b65e8050d7fa3aa380c4c45f56cf413d4f06a4e450c1b109c1882381d90aa
confirmations
151397
spent
true